Cumanacoa
Photo: Veronidae,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Cumanacoa is a city in Venezuela's Sucre State. its population is approximately 18,800 inhabitants, the building of the city was started in 1585, and eventually founded in the year 1617 by Captain Baltasar de Arias, with the name of San Baltasar Cumanacoa Arias.
